|
|
|
Ошибка №3251 при попытке экспорта в xls
|
|||
|---|---|---|---|
|
#18+
День добрый всем присутствующим. (перепостил сообщение в этот раздел форума) Пользую программу, которая работает по схеме "клиент-сервер" на MSDE (DesktopEdition). Попытался сделать экспорт данных в Excel и в ответ получил такое вот ругательство: Ошибка №3251 Описание: Current provider does not support transactions. В тот же access экспорт без проблем. Помогите, пожалуйста, прояснить ситуацию...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.08.2006, 12:27 |
|
||
|
Ошибка №3251 при попытке экспорта в xls
|
|||
|---|---|---|---|
|
#18+
Формируется примерно такая вот строка соединения: Provider=MSDASQL.1;Persist Security Info=False;Data Source=Excel Files;Initial Catalog=C:\..... MSDASQL.1 - почему же это чудо не хочет поддерживать транзакции?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.08.2006, 13:42 |
|
||
|
Ошибка №3251 при попытке экспорта в xls
|
|||
|---|---|---|---|
|
#18+
Интересно каким образом вы используете MSSQL-провайдер для доступа к Excel-файлам. Обычно для этого используют JET OleDb-провайдер. www.connectionstrings.com А Excel действительно не поддерживает транзакции, т.ч. меняйте код приложения.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.08.2006, 15:52 |
|
||
|
Ошибка №3251 при попытке экспорта в xls
|
|||
|---|---|---|---|
|
#18+
Хочется доступ с пом. ODBC...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.08.2006, 08:09 |
|
||
|
Ошибка №3251 при попытке экспорта в xls
|
|||
|---|---|---|---|
|
#18+
авторХочется доступ с пом. ODBC... А причем здесь ODBC?! Хотите - используйте, но тогда и строку соединения нужно указывать соответствующую. См. на указанном сайте.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 21.08.2006, 10:20 |
|
||
|
Ошибка №3251 при попытке экспорта в xls
|
|||
|---|---|---|---|
|
#18+
BigheadmanИнтересно каким образом вы используете MSSQL-провайдер для доступа к Excel-файлам. Обычно для этого используют JET OleDb-провайдер. strCnn = "Provider=MSDASQL.1;Persist Security Info=False;Data Source=Excel Files;Mode=ReadWrite;DSN=Excel Files;DBQ=z:\dll\book1.xls;DriverId=790;MaxBufferSize=2048;PageTimeout=5;" вот таким вот образом другие люди пользуют MSDASQL...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.08.2006, 08:52 |
|
||
|
Ошибка №3251 при попытке экспорта в xls
|
|||
|---|---|---|---|
|
#18+
Вы бы все-таки посмотрели примеры на http://www.connectionstrings.com/ . Там предлагаются другие строки соединения. И тем не менее, Excel не поддерживает транзакции. Какую бы строку соединения вы ни использовали!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.08.2006, 10:56 |
|
||
|
Ошибка №3251 при попытке экспорта в xls
|
|||
|---|---|---|---|
|
#18+
BigheadmanВы бы все-таки посмотрели примеры на http://www.connectionstrings.com/ . Там предлагаются другие строки соединения. И тем не менее, Excel не поддерживает транзакции. Какую бы строку соединения вы ни использовали! спасибо большое за долготерпение! :) Действительно, в софтине как то не была полностью учтена возможность использования в excel, т.е. по умолчанию, без проверок включались транзакции...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.08.2006, 09:48 |
|
||
|
|

start [/forum/topic.php?fid=17&fpage=105&tid=1353196]: |
0ms |
get settings: |
10ms |
get forum list: |
17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
56ms |
get topic data: |
12ms |
get forum data: |
3ms |
get page messages: |
53ms |
get tp. blocked users: |
2ms |
| others: | 229ms |
| total: | 390ms |

| 0 / 0 |
